We’re excited to unveil a brand new Amazon Mechanical Turk (MTurk) Worker website we are working on, and we’d like your help to make it the best possible place for finding and completing tasks in MTurk. We’ve redesigned the browse and search experience to make it simpler, more efficient, and adaptive to the devices you use. Besides a refreshed look and feel, here are just some of the improvements so far:

  • We’ve created a fluid layout while optimizing your experience by prominently displaying key Project and Task (HIT) information. Doing this supports browsing and discovery of Tasks across mobile phones, tablets, or desktop computers.
  • Along with adjusting the layout of the page, we’ve reduced the page header and footer to show twice as much content on a typical screen.
  • To speed up finding Tasks to work on, only Projects matching your Qualifications are shown by default.
  • You can quickly sort Projects with one click on the column header.
  • New Accept & Work button lets you accept Tasks you like with one click.
  • Project creation time lets you grasp how fresh a Project at a glance.
  • Worker ID is always present at the top of page for easy access.

As we make improvements, we want to share the work in progress with you. When you use the new browse and search experience, you may see a mix of new and current pages, and you may be prompted to sign in again when transitioning from a new page to a current page. These transitions will go away as we complete the new site.
